Making Health Boards accountable
Good to see that the Scottish Government is pressing forward with
plans to bring in some directly-elected members of Health Boards.
Some recent decisions to change the way NHS services in Scotland
are delivered have raised strong feeling in local communities and
many people believe that some NHS Boards have not taken sufficient
account of the views of local people. The Government understands
that difficult decisions about NHS services have to be made. It
also believes, however, that local people must always be at the
heart of the process, and that the service change process should be
rigorous, evidence-based, and open to scrutiny.
